Interesting facts about Mumbai to Porbandar trains

3 trains run from Mumbai to Porbandar , including 2 superfast trains.
The fastest train from Mumbai to Porbandar is 20909 TVCN PBR SF EXP which travels a distance of 906 kms in just 15 hours and 55 minutes.

The minimum fare for trains from Mumbai to Porbandar is Rs 3040 in First AC (1A), Rs 1750 in Second AC (2A), Rs 1225 in Third AC (3A) and Rs 455 in Sleeper (SL) in general quota.
Tatkal ticket fare and premium tatkal fare in this route starts from Rs 2260 in Second AC (2A), Rs 1575 in Third AC (3A) and Rs 585 in Sleeper (SL).
Important railway stations in this route are Vapi, Surat, Ankleshwar Jn, Vadodara Jn, Anand Jn, Nadiad Jn, Ahmedabad Jn, Viramgam Jn, Surendranagar and Rajkot Jn.
Mumbai has 15 stations namely Lokmanya Tilak Term, Mumbai Cst, Mumbai Bandra Terminus, Mumbai Central, Mumbai Dadar Central, Mumbai Dadar West, Panvel, Kalyan Jn, Thane, Borivali, Vasai Road, Virar, Andheri, Chhatrapati Shivaji Maharaj Terminus and Mumbai Central while Porbandar has 1 stations namely Porbandar.
